Въпрос относно плъгина който прехвърля при 31/32

Въпроси и проблеми свързани с AMXModX.
Аватар
petr0w
Извън линия
Потребител
Потребител
Мнения: 222
Регистриран на: 31 Окт 2016, 02:38
Се отблагодари: 5 пъти
Получена благодарност: 14 пъти
Обратна връзка:

Въпрос относно плъгина който прехвърля при 31/32

Мнение от petr0w » 15 Дек 2020, 00:41

Да започнем от това, че съм наясно че valve са забранили това.

Нещото което намерих и е най ефикасно е написано от Croma.

Код за потвърждение: Избери целия код

#include <amxmodx>

new g_pMaxPlayers, g_pServerIP, g_iLastPlayer

public plugin_init()
{
	register_plugin("Redirect when Full", "1.0", "OciXCrom")
	g_pMaxPlayers = register_cvar("redirect_maxplayers", "31")
	g_pServerIP = register_cvar("redirect_to_ip", "93.123.18.**:270**")
}

public client_authorized(id)
{
	new bool:bImmunity = bool:(get_user_flags(id) & ADMIN_IMMUNITY)
	
	if(get_playersnum() >= get_pcvar_num(g_pMaxPlayers))
	{
		if(bImmunity)
			redirect_user(is_user_connected(g_iLastPlayer) ? g_iLastPlayer : id)
		else
			redirect_user(id)
	}
	
	if(!bImmunity)
		g_iLastPlayer = id
}

redirect_user(const id)
{
	static szIP[20]
	get_pcvar_string(g_pServerIP, szIP, charsmax(szIP))
	client_cmd(id, "wait;wait;wait;wait;wait;^"connect^" %s", szIP)
}
Понякога не прехвърля и допуска юзърите да влезат във сървъра и така той става 32/32. Та въпросът ми е, трябва ли да добавя нещо от рода на админслот и да резервирам един ?
Bulgarska Trewa -91.132.63.63:27015

Аватар
EKOLOGA
Извън линия
Потребител
Потребител
Мнения: 89
Регистриран на: 26 Дек 2016, 04:26
Местоположение: plovdiv
Получена благодарност: 6 пъти
Обратна връзка:

Въпрос относно плъгина който прехвърля при 31/32

Мнение от EKOLOGA » 18 Яну 2021, 19:34

ОФФ БОЖЕ не знам колко ти е читаво но погледни този код по добре доста по добър е от твоя ;)

Цвари към плъгина слагат се в amxx.cfg

//XRedirect
redirect_active 1
redirect_auto 1
redirect_manual 2
redirect_follow 0
redirect_announce 60
redirect_check_method 2
redirect_announce_mode 3
redirect_announce_alivepos_x 1.0 // - вертикална позиция към съобщения, обявени от потребители vii (по подразбиране -1.0)
redirect_announce_alivepos_y 0,01 // - хоризонтална позиция и съобщения, обявени от потребителите vii (по подразбиране 0,01)
redirect_announce_deadpos_x -1.0 // - вертикална позиция на визуализациите на съобщението да умре (по подразбиране -1.0)
redirect_announce_deadpos_y 0.35 // - хоризонтална позиция за публикация, обявена от хоросан (по подразбиране 0.35)
redirect_show 0 // 0 - показва се reconectare във формат чат (по подразбиране 1)
redirect_adminslots 1 // 1/0 - активира деактивира слотове за админи
redirect_maxadmins 0 // - максимален брой брави, които могат да бъдат изградени по едно и също време, 0 = безкрайност (по подразбиране 0)
redirect_retry 1 // 0 - (повторен опит) автомати. Изтегляне на кандидатурата за събирач / повторен опит за автоматично възстановяване на автоматичен сървър за настройка на сървъра (по подразбиране 0)
redirect_hidedown 3
Прикачени файлове
xredirect.zip
Всички файлове към плъгина
(64.63 KiB) Свалено 93 пъти
xredirect.zip
Всички файлове към плъгина
(64.63 KiB) Свалено 93 пъти
Последно промяна от EKOLOGA на 22 Яну 2021, 15:27, променено общо 2 пъти.
Изображение
Изображение

IP: 93.123.16.44:27015

FPS: 10000 (TEN-THOUSAND!)
SITE: www.CS-PARADISE.EU

CS-PARADISE.EU е верига игрални сървъри ориентирана към зрялата аудитория на неостаряващата класика Counter-Strike 1.6

» Уникалена cheat system - НИКАКВИ ХАКЕРИ
» 10000 FPS (ДЕСЕТ ХИЛЯДИ!) - НИКАКЪВ ЛАГ
» Гигабитова свързаност - НАЙ-НИСКИЯТ ПИНГ
» Професионална поддръжка - НАЙ-ЯКИТЕ НАСТРОЙКИ
» Непрестанно обновяване - НАЙ-НОВИТЕ МОДОВЕ

С нас ще преоткриеш CS 1.6 в безкомпромисни сървъри, където честната игра е гарантирана от уникалната ни защита!

ВНИМАНИЕ:
ПРИ НАС СТРЕЛЯТ ДОСТА СИЛНИ ИГРАЧИ!
ДОРИ СРЕД МОМИЧЕТАТА ИМА БРУТАЛНИ
----------------------
Изображение

Аватар
OciXCrom
Извън линия
Администратор
Администратор
Мнения: 7206
Регистриран на: 06 Окт 2016, 19:20
Местоположение: /resetscore
Се отблагодари: 117 пъти
Получена благодарност: 1295 пъти
Обратна връзка:

Въпрос относно плъгина който прехвърля при 31/32

Мнение от OciXCrom » 21 Яну 2021, 00:44

@EKOLOGA да, направо е супер този код който никога няма да успееш да компилираш. :) Не се излагай с декомпилирани плъгини и не давай оценка като нямаш грам понятие от нещата.

Ако не прехвърля, това е по-скоро защото играта на последния влезнал играч е защитена и не работи redirect върху него.

Аватар
EKOLOGA
Извън линия
Потребител
Потребител
Мнения: 89
Регистриран на: 26 Дек 2016, 04:26
Местоположение: plovdiv
Получена благодарност: 6 пъти
Обратна връзка:

Въпрос относно плъгина който прехвърля при 31/32

Мнение от EKOLOGA » 22 Яну 2021, 02:15

Добре извини ме приятел оправих се :) Едитнал съм предния пост дано да му е станало ясно сега относно плъгина!
Изображение
Изображение

IP: 93.123.16.44:27015

FPS: 10000 (TEN-THOUSAND!)
SITE: www.CS-PARADISE.EU

CS-PARADISE.EU е верига игрални сървъри ориентирана към зрялата аудитория на неостаряващата класика Counter-Strike 1.6

» Уникалена cheat system - НИКАКВИ ХАКЕРИ
» 10000 FPS (ДЕСЕТ ХИЛЯДИ!) - НИКАКЪВ ЛАГ
» Гигабитова свързаност - НАЙ-НИСКИЯТ ПИНГ
» Професионална поддръжка - НАЙ-ЯКИТЕ НАСТРОЙКИ
» Непрестанно обновяване - НАЙ-НОВИТЕ МОДОВЕ

С нас ще преоткриеш CS 1.6 в безкомпромисни сървъри, където честната игра е гарантирана от уникалната ни защита!

ВНИМАНИЕ:
ПРИ НАС СТРЕЛЯТ ДОСТА СИЛНИ ИГРАЧИ!
ДОРИ СРЕД МОМИЧЕТАТА ИМА БРУТАЛНИ
----------------------
Изображение

Публикувай отговор
  • Подобни теми
    Отговори
    Преглеждания
     Последно мнение

Обратно към “Поддръжка / Помощ”

Кой е на линия

Потребители разглеждащи този форум: Google [Bot] и 12 госта